Output 68a62814196d3bbbe3426128dceb64a4bf7a4ed6987e4379c9cfa044469b4a83:1

value
362634
script pubkey
OP_0 OP_PUSHBYTES_20 8e8c259d8fb659c1a86ae3019b8f58717e9542f0
address
bc1q36xzt8v0kevur2r2uvqehr6cw9lf2shsylv026
transaction
68a62814196d3bbbe3426128dceb64a4bf7a4ed6987e4379c9cfa044469b4a83
confirmations
99162
spent
true